Fairway Springs Subdivision in New Port Richey, Florida is located in the Trinity-New Port Richey area off SR 54; west of the Duck Slough area and the new Community Hospital. Conveniently located close to Mitchell Crossing Shopping Center with a Publix Supermarket, Pet Smart, Target, and Chili’s Restaurant. Built in the early to mid-80’s, Fairway Springs has a clubhouse and pool. The Homeowners Association dues are  $295.00/year for access to the pool and clubhouse, and maintenance of the common elements. The Fairway Springs HOA can be viewed here.  The neighborhood is pet-friendly. And, despite its name, there is no golf course connected with the subdivision.   Which Government Backed Home Loan Is Best Suited For Purchasing My New Home? If you want a loan with a No Money Down Option then you must be a veteran or you must purchase a home in a HUD Approved Area for Rural Housing. The VA and USDA Loan are the only type loans that offer the No Down Payment Option for buying a home. The FHA loan is the most popular type loan at this time because the down payment requirement is only 3.5% compared to the Conventional Loans which require 5% down. Both require the added cost of Mortgage Insurance any time less than 20% down is used. The VA and USDA Loans do not require mortgage Insurance but have a funding fee that is financed into the loan.
